Comparable to any other home renovation option, there is a lot to believe about while planning for a loft conversion. Whether you desire to create an aesthetic living space or to have a playroom for your children, ample options are accessible to choose from to suit every budget. Here are some of the significant elements that you require to think about to have your ideal attic conversion. So begin your planning by thinking about the below talked about points.

- Assess the feasibility of a conversion

A loft with adequate headroom and floor space is always regarded as perfect for an attic conversion. Get a professional builder's help to evaluate the suitability of your space.

- Determine the advantages you can gain

It is vital to evaluate the benefits you can obtain through a viable loft conversion. Usually bear in mind that it will improve the general market worth of your residential property. In most instances, you can add up to 20% of the actual cost. You also require to make certain that the construction accommodates all of your specifications in the best way possible.

- Establish a budget for your conversion

Another essential planning step is to establish a budget for your attic conversion. When minimal structural modification is needed, the price of a conversion is considered to be comparatively lower than other home extension options.

- Decide the suitable kind of loft conversion

A wide variety of attic conversion options are accessible such as Mansard, Dormer, Velux, Hip to Gable, Hip End, Cottage or Pitched Dormer, Hip to Gable Rear Dormer, Roof Lift and many much more. It is sensible to choose a appropriate one based on the construction of your property, roof type and budget.

- Analyse building regulations and party wall

Prior to planning a loft conversion job, you should be conscious about the need of planning permission or a party wall agreement. A loft or attic conversion for your property house is regarded to be permitted development, not necessitating an application for planning permission, topic to particular conditions and limits. Even although all popular loft conversion jobs are classed as a permitted development, it is advisable to submit your attic conversion design to your nearby planning authority for approval. An additional main consideration is to procure a party wall agreement, particularly if you reside in a terraced or semi-detached house.
